OCSPSigningFlag
列挙型メンバー 10
| 名前 | 10進 | 16進 |
|---|---|---|
| OCSP_SF_SILENT | 1 | 0x1 |
| OCSP_SF_USE_CACERT | 2 | 0x2 |
| OCSP_SF_ALLOW_SIGNINGCERT_AUTORENEWAL | 4 | 0x4 |
| OCSP_SF_FORCE_SIGNINGCERT_ISSUER_ISCA | 8 | 0x8 |
| OCSP_SF_AUTODISCOVER_SIGNINGCERT | 16 | 0x10 |
| OCSP_SF_MANUAL_ASSIGN_SIGNINGCERT | 32 | 0x20 |
| OCSP_SF_RESPONDER_ID_KEYHASH | 64 | 0x40 |
| OCSP_SF_RESPONDER_ID_NAME | 128 | 0x80 |
| OCSP_SF_ALLOW_NONCE_EXTENSION | 256 | 0x100 |
| OCSP_SF_ALLOW_SIGNINGCERT_AUTOENROLLMENT | 512 | 0x200 |
